Temperature level Considerations



When it concerns business exterior paint, temperature plays a critical duty in the result of your project. If you're painting in severe warm, the paint can dry too quickly, causing issues like bad adhesion and uneven coatings. You want to go for temperatures between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for the best results. Below 50 ° F, paint might not cure properly, while over 85 ° F, you take the chance of blistering and fracturing.

Humidity Levels



Moisture levels significantly impact the success of your commercial external painting job. When the humidity is too expensive, it can hinder paint drying and treating, causing a range of issues like inadequate bond and finish quality.

If you're intending a task throughout damp conditions, you may locate that the paint takes longer to dry, which can prolong your job timeline and increase expenses.

Alternatively, reduced humidity can likewise posture difficulties. Paint may dry out also quickly, preventing correct application and causing an uneven finish.

You'll wish to keep an eye on the humidity levels very closely to guarantee you're working within the excellent array, generally in between 40% and 70%.

To get the best outcomes, take into consideration using a hygrometer to measure moisture prior to starting your job.

If you find the levels are outside the ideal array, you may need to readjust your schedule or select paints developed for variable problems.

Always speak with the producer's standards for certain recommendations on moisture tolerance.

Precipitation Impact



Rain or snow can significantly interrupt your business exterior paint plans. When rainfall happens, it can wash away fresh applied paint or develop an irregular coating. Preferably, you intend to pick days with completely dry weather to guarantee the paint adheres correctly and cures properly. If you're captured in a rain shower, it's best to halt the task and await problems to boost.

Additionally, snow can be even more destructive. Not just does it create a wet surface, yet it can also lower temperature levels, making it difficult for paint to completely dry. This can lead to issues like peeling off or blistering down the line.

It's critical to inspect the weather prediction before starting your task. If rain or snow is anticipated, take into consideration rescheduling.


Always remember to enable ample drying out time in between coats, specifically if the climate continues to be unpredictable.
